Tyler Sammons and Ethan Wall may not have the stature of those legends, but they were earning some consideration after helping the Fairland Dragons beat the South Point Pointers 14-1 in a run rule Ohio Valley Conference win on Monday.

Sammons and Walls combined on a 3-hitter for the Dragons as they put up some impressive numbers.

Sammons started and went 3 innings to get the win. He gave up 2 hits, no runs, struck out 8 and did not walk a batter. Walls allowed one hit, an earned run with 3 strikeouts and one walk in 2 innings of work.

The Dragons were strong offensively as well as they collected 11 hits.

Niko Kiritsy swung a big bat as he went 2-3 with a triple and 3 runs batted in. Wall helped himself as he went 1-3 with 3 RBI.

Blaze Perry was 2-3 with 2 RBI, Brycen Hunt was 2-3, Tayler Sammons was 1-2 with an RBI, Cooper Cummings 1-3 with an RBI, Alex Morgan 1-1 and Alex Rogers 1-3 .

Blaine Henry was 1-1, Joey Labaldo 1-2 and Ethan Layne 1-2 with an RBI to pace the Pointers.
